CLERK'S CORNER - Special Weekend Hours for Dog LicensingOn Saturday, April 5, the Town Clerks will be open from 8:00am -11:00am for dog licensing only. Please bring most recent rabies certificate for each dog. Each dog that is licensed before April 30 will be entered into the Top Dog of Stratham contest!
Sunday, April 6th from 1:00-3:00 pm in the Morgera Room, Stratham Fire Station, 4 Winnicutt Road
Come find out what your family heirlooms and treasures are worth! Our experts will appraise a variety of antiques and collectibles including: furniture, works of art, jewelry, military memorabilia, photographs, china, glass, etc. You can bring a photo of large furniture and other large items. $5 for one item, $8 for two items, $12 for three items and $15 for four items. We ask that you respect a limit of five items. Fees benefit the Stratham Historical Society. Click here for more details!

Green Grass, Clean Water - May 9, 2:30 - 4:30
Join us for this free hands-on lawn care clinic led by UNH Cooperative Extension. Learn how to grow a healthy and attractive lawn using techniques that help keep our lakes, rivers and bays clean. Free soil tests will be offered to all participants. Learn more and register here:
